AN ACT to amend the social services law, in relation to child care
assistance for victims of domestic violence
TH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M-
B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
Section 1. Paragraphs (d) and (e) of subdivision 1 of section 410-w of
the social services law, as amended by section 2 of part L of chapter 56
of the laws of 2022, are amended and a new paragraph (f) is added to
read as follows:
(d) families with incomes up to two hundred percent of the state
income standard, or three hundred percent of the state income standard
effective August first, two thousand twenty-two, who are attending a
post secondary educational program; provided, the family income does not
exceed eighty-five percent of the state median income; [and]
(e) other families with incomes up to two hundred percent of the state
income standard, or three hundred percent of the state income standard
effective August first, two thousand twenty-two, which the social
services district designates in its consolidated services plan as eligi-
ble for child care assistance in accordance with criteria established by
the department; provided, the family income does not exceed eighty-five
percent of the state median income[.]; AND
(F) VICTIMS OF DOMESTIC VIOLENCE AS DEFINED IN SECTION FOUR HUNDRED
EIGHTY-ONE-C OF THIS CHAPTER WHO ARE IN NEED OF ASSISTANCE IN ORDER FOR
A PARENT OR CARETAKER RELATIVE TO ENGAGE IN WORK OR PARTICIPATE IN WORK
ACTIVITIES PURSUANT TO THE PROVISIONS OF TITLE NINE-B OF ARTICLE FIVE OF
THIS CHAPTER.
§ 2. This act shall take effect immediately.
EXPLANATION--Matter in ITALICS (underscored) is new; matter in brackets
[ ] is old law to be omitted.
